Chest

Oak, with carved decoration, of pegged construction with linenfold carving on front panels. At each end of the chest inside are channels showing the position of old herb boxes. Size: Length: 174 cm; Height: 73 cm; Width: 56 cm

Place: England

Object Type: chest

Actual Date: c. 1487

Century: 15th century

Material: Oak

Museum Accession Number: 1974.106.3/FW
